The US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) has added Italy to its highest-risk category in its latest travel advisory issued on 13 December.
The CDC has placed Italy in the ‘Level 4: Covid-19 Very High’ category, along with more than 80 other countries, many of them in Europe.
Advising US travelers to avoid going to Italy, the CDC warns that “if you must travel, make sure you are fully vaccinated” before traveling.
US has recently lifted travel restrictions for fully vaccinated and covid-tested air travelers from Italy last month, ending a travel ban in place for a year and a half.
